/* CSS Document */

#bj{ background:url(../images/bj.jpg) top no-repeat;  margin:0 auto;}


img{border:0;}


a{ color:#999; text-decoration:none;}
a:hover{ color:#fff; text-decoration:none;}

.z_kf a{ color:#fff; text-decoration:none}
.z_kf a:hover{ color:#fffd94; text-decoration:none;}


a.wz{ color:#fff; text-decoration:none; font-size:13px;}
a.wz:hover{ color:#FFF; text-decoration:underline;}


/* top */
	.top{ width:984px; margin:0 auto;}
		.top_1{ width:984px; margin:0 auto;}
		.top_2{ width:984px; margin:0 auto;}
			.top_z{ background:url(../images/Index_04.jpg) no-repeat; width:342px; height:106px; float:left;}
				.z_wz1{ font-family:"宋体"; font-size:14px; font-weight:bold; color:#979797; line-height:46px; text-align:right; padding-right:5px;}
				.z_wz2{ font-family:"宋体"; font-size:12px; font-weight:bold; color:#fff; line-height:40px; text-align:right; padding-right:5px;}
			.top_c{ float:left; width:305px;height:106px; overflow:hidden; background:url(/template/default/images/Index_05.jpg);}
			.top_r{ background:url(../images/Index_06.jpg) no-repeat; width:337px; height:106px; float:right;}
				.r_wz1{ font-family:"宋体"; font-size:14px; font-weight:bold; color:#979797; line-height:46px; text-align:left; padding-left:5px;}
				.r_wz2{ font-family:"宋体"; font-size:12px; font-weight:bold; color:#fff; line-height:40px; text-align:left; padding-left:5px;}

		.top_3{ width:984px; margin:0 auto;}
			.top_l{ width:984px; height:80px; float:left;}
				.top_l li{ float:left;}





/* zhongjianbuf */

	.zjbuf{ width:984px; margin:0 auto;}
	
		.zj_z{ width:264px; float:left; background:url(../images/Index_12.jpg) no-repeat; overflow:hidden;}
			.z_kf{ width:264px; height:129px; background:url(../images/Index_21.jpg) no-repeat; overflow:hidden;}
			.kf_wz{ font-size:14px; font-weight:bold; color:#FFF; line-height:17px;}
			
		
		.zj_c{ float:left;}
		.z_zs{width:214px;height:261px; background:url(/template/default/images/Index_25.jpg) no-repeat; padding-left:50px; padding-top:15px;}
		
		.zj_r{ width:710px; float:right; }
			.r_gfgg{ height:139px; width:466px; float:left; overflow:hidden;}
			
			.gg_z{ width:466px; height:44px; float:left; background:url(../images/Index_14.jpg) no-repeat top;  overflow:hidden;}
				.gd{ line-height:44px; font-size:10px; font-weight:bold; float:right; padding-right:25px; }
			.gg_x{ width:466px; height:95px; background:url(../images/Index_16.jpg) no-repeat; overflow:hidden;padding-left:1px;}
				.x_wz{ color:#fff; padding-left:1px; line-height:0px; }
				
				
				
			.r_fwq{ width:244px; height:139px; float:right; overflow:hidden;}
				.fwq_s{ width:244px; height:44px; background:url(../images/Index_15.jpg) top no-repeat; float:right; overflow:hidden;}
				.fwq_x{ width:244px; height:95px; background:url(../images/Index_17.jpg) top no-repeat; overflow:hidden;}
				/*		.x_z{ width:9px; height:17px; float:left; padding-left:5px; margin-top:29px;}
					.fwq_wz{ font-size:14px; font-weight:bold; color:#FFF; line-height:20px; width:150px; margin:0 auto; overflow:hidden; text-align:center;}
					.x_r{ width:9px; float:right; margin-right:27px; margin-top:29px; overflow:hidden}		
					server。aspx\ ifmame 中 旁边的 */




			
			.yxte{ width:710px; height:225px; background:url(../images/Index_19.jpg) top no-repeat; overflow:hidden;}
				.te_fl{ width:120px; height:225px; float:left; display:inline;}
				.te_wz{ color:#FFF; line-height:22px; font-size:12px; width:530px; }
				
				
				
			.gylz{ width:710px; height:317px;}	
				.gymj{ width:410px; float:left}
					.mj_x{ width:410px; height:117px; background: url(../images/Index_26.jpg) top no-repeat; padding-top:5px;}
					.mj_wz{ color:#FFF; font-size:12px; line-height:22px;}
				
				.jcjt{ width:300px; height:163px; float:right}
					.jt_x{ width:300px; height:122px; background:url(../images/Index_27.jpg) top no-repeat;}
						.x_tp{ float: left; margin-top:10px; margin-left:20px !important; margin-left:10px;}
							.tp_wz{ font-size:12px; color:#FFF; line-height:26px; }
						.x_tp1{ float:left; margin-top:10px; margin-left:16px!important; margin-left:8px;}
				
				
				
				
			.wjxq{ width:710px;}	
				.wjlz{ width:364px; float:left}
					.lz_wz{ color:#FFF; font-size:12px; line-height:22px;}
					.lz_s{ width:364px; height:31px;}
					.lz_x{ width:364px; height:123px; background:url(../images/Index_30.jpg) top no-repeat; float:left}
						.x_tp{ float: left; margin-top:10px;_margin-left:5px }
							.tp_wz{ font-size:12px; color:#FFF; line-height:26px; }
						.x_tp1{ float:left; margin-top:10px; margin-left:14px;}
						.x_tp2{ float:left; margin-top:10px; margin-left:14px;}
						
						
				.xqgs{ width:346px; float:right;}
					.gs_s{ width:346px; height:31px;}
					
					.gs_x{ width:346px; height:113px; background: url(../images/Index_31.jpg) top no-repeat; padding-top:10px;}
						.gs_wz{ font-size:12px; color:#FFF; line-height:20px;}
				
				
				

	.footer{ width:984px;  margin:0 auto; padding-top:12px; height:138px; overflow:hidden; clear:both;}
		.footer_bj{ width:984px; height:138px; background:url(../images/footer_11.jpg) no-repeat;}
		.foot_wz{ font-size:12px; color:#8bb0da; line-height:32px;}
		.foot_wz1{ font-size:12px; color:#8bb0da; line-height:24px;}
	
	
	
	
/* neiye  */	
	
	.nye_r{ width:710px; float:right; }
		.nye_s{ width:710px; height:35px; background:url(../images/neiye_03.jpg) top no-repeat;}
		.nye_z{ width:710px; background:url(../images/neiye_06.jpg) repeat-y;}
			.ny_zj{ width:710px; background:url(../images/neiye_05.jpg) no-repeat; }
		.nye_x{}
					.nye_wz{ font-size:12px; font-weight:bold; color:#FFF; line-height:35px; padding-left:16px;}
					.ny_zjwz{ font-size:12px; color:#8bb0da; line-height:35px;}
		a.ny{ color:#8bb0da; text-decoration:none;}
		a.ny:hover{ color:#fff; text-decoration:none;}			
					
					
				
			
					
					